This is going to sound like the silliest question in the world, but my copy of The Sims 2 runs horribly on my (newish) laptop. Would this have anything to do with me running the game off of a dvd instead of a cd?

The next thing I'm going to try to do is see if I can find newer drivers for my video card. Where on my computer can I find my video and sound cards listed? Is googling generally the best way to find new drivers?

That's a possibility- I'll look at a cd-rom edition today and see if the info is any different. So far I've looked at the processor and memory, which should both be more than adequate, so I'm going back to the video card- the instructions say that if the most up to date driver isn't installed, it can interfere with game function, and that the video card must have more than 32 MB of memory and one of these T&L capable chipsets: ATI Radeon 7200 or greater, or NVIDIA GeForce2 or greater.
